程序员茄子
全部
编程
代码
资讯
案例
综合
联系我们
html在线编辑
登录注册
AI,自己全程接管维护
php
mysql
shell
go
vue
css
api接口对接
支付接口对接
最新
最热
MySQL JSON字段避坑指南:这些场景用对效率翻倍!
编程
MySQL JSON字段避坑指南:这些场景用对效率翻倍!
2025-08-22 21:31:53 +0800 CST
view 867
本文探讨了MySQL中JSON字段的使用注意事项,强调了在关系型数据库中使用JSON的潜在性能陷阱。适合使用JSON字段的场景包括稀疏字段和动态属性,而不适合的场景则包括需要频繁查询和建立索引的数据。提供了创建表、插入数据、查询和修改JSON数据的示例,以及性能优化的建议和常见陷阱的解决方案。
数据库
开发
性能优化
编程
MySQL 优化利剑 EXPLAIN
2024-11-19 00:43:21 +0800 CST
view 1420
在MySQL中,EXPLAIN是一种强大的工具,用于分析SQL查询的执行计划,帮助识别性能问题并进行优化。通过EXPLAIN,用户可以了解查询的执行顺序、访问表的方式、使用的索引等信息,从而优化查询性能。优化建议包括避免全表扫描、使用合适的索引、减少数据读取量等。EXPLAIN的输出字段提供了详细的执行信息,有助于开发者进行有效的性能调优。
数据库
性能优化
SQL
MySQL
查询分析
mysql 优化指南
编程
mysql 优化指南
2024-11-18 21:01:24 +0800 CST
view 1327
本文提供了一系列SQL优化的最佳实践,包括避免使用SELECT*、在WHERE子句中使用OR的替代方案、使用数值类型代替字符串、优化JOIN和GROUPBY操作等。通过这些策略,可以有效提升查询性能,减少资源消耗,确保数据库系统的高效稳定运行。
数据库
性能优化
编程技巧
MySQL中使用LIMIT进行分页查询的多种方法及其优化策略
编程
MySQL中使用LIMIT进行分页查询的多种方法及其优化策略
2024-11-18 17:47:12 +0800 CST
view 1222
本文介绍了在MySQL中使用LIMIT进行分页查询的多种方法及其优化策略。通过对订单历史表的测试,分析了不同查询方式的效率,包括一般分页查询、使用子查询优化、ID限定优化和临时表优化。总结指出,合理使用这些技术可以显著提高在大数据量环境下的查询效率。
数据库
MySQL
性能优化
编程
为什么要放弃UUID作为MySQL主键?
2024-11-18 23:33:07 +0800 CST
view 1578
本文探讨了在MySQL中使用UUID和雪花算法作为主键的优缺点。虽然UUID提供全球唯一性,但在存储空间、性能、排序和并发处理方面,雪花算法更具优势。雪花算法生成的ID为64位,节省存储空间,且在高并发环境下表现优异。最终,选择雪花算法作为主键是基于性能和数据库操作效率的考虑。
数据库设计
ID生成
性能优化
分布式系统
MySQL死锁 - 更新插入导致死锁
编程
MySQL死锁 - 更新插入导致死锁
2024-11-19 05:53:50 +0800 CST
view 1287
本文分析了MySQL死锁的原因及解决方法。通过一个实际案例,展示了在并发执行更新和插入操作时如何导致死锁,并提供了优化建议,如先查询再更新或插入、避免大范围数据修改和合理使用索引,以减少锁冲突,防止死锁的发生。
数据库
性能优化
事务管理
PostgreSQL 18 深度解析:3倍I/O提速与面向未来的内核级革新
编程
PostgreSQL 18 深度解析:3倍I/O提速与面向未来的内核级革新
2026-04-17 11:45:58 +0800 CST
view 137
深度解析 PostgreSQL 18 核心新特性:全新 I/O 子系统带来 3 倍读取性能提升,虚拟生成列、uuidv7()、OAuth 2.0 认证等重磅功能的技术原理与实战指南。
PostgreSQL
数据库
性能优化
I/O
分布式
数据库基础设施范式转移:PostgreSQL 18 从3倍I/O提速到OAuth SSO的完整技术解析
编程
数据库基础设施范式转移:PostgreSQL 18 从3倍I/O提速到OAuth SSO的完整技术解析
2026-04-17 11:46:28 +0800 CST
view 249
深度解析 PostgreSQL 18 数据库新版本:全新 I/O 子系统实现 3 倍读取性能提升,虚拟生成列、uuidv7()、OAuth 2.0 认证等核心特性的架构原理与生产环境实战指南。
PostgreSQL
数据库
性能优化
I/O
OAuth
PostgreSQL 18 深度解析:当世界上最先进的开源数据库再次进化
编程
PostgreSQL 18 深度解析:当世界上最先进的开源数据库再次进化
2026-04-08 15:22:57 +0800 CST
view 326
深度解析PostgreSQL 18核心新特性:I/O子系统重构带来3倍性能提升、虚拟生成列、uuidv7()分布式ID、OAuth 2.0认证支持等,附完整代码示例和实战指南
PostgreSQL
数据库
开源
性能优化
新特性
sql语句分别按日,按周,按月,按季统计金额
编程
sql语句分别按日,按周,按月,按季统计金额
2024-11-17 05:05:22 +0800 CST
view 2903
本文讨论如何使用SQL语句按日、周、月和季节统计消费记录的总量。提供了四条SQL示例语句,分别实现不同时间段的消费总和计算,并说明了如何根据指定日期进行查询。示例中使用了聚合函数和groupby语句,适用于消费记录表的分析。
数据库
SQL
数据分析
批量导入scv数据库
编程
批量导入scv数据库
2024-11-17 05:07:51 +0800 CST
view 2931
本文介绍了如何进行MySQL环境检测,特别是关于secure_auth和secure_file_priv变量的设置。通过修改my.ini文件并重启MySQL,可以启用secure_auth。接着,提供了使用LOADDATAINFILE命令将UTF-8编码的文本文件导入数据库的核心代码示例。
数据库
MySQL
数据导入
使用 Go 语言并发处理 CSV 文件到数据库
编程
使用 Go 语言并发处理 CSV 文件到数据库
2024-11-18 12:08:55 +0800 CST
view 1567
本文介绍了如何使用Go语言的并发特性高效地将CSV文件中的联系人信息迁移到数据库。通过使用goroutine和channel,本文展示了并发处理的实现方式,并提供了完整的代码示例,包括数据结构定义、错误处理和最终响应生成。此方法显著提升了数据迁移的速度,适用于大规模数据处理。
编程
数据处理
Go语言
并发编程
数据库
mysql int bigint 自增索引范围
编程
mysql int bigint 自增索引范围
2024-11-18 07:29:12 +0800 CST
view 3090
本文介绍了Mysql中INT和BIGINT数据类型的定义及其范围。INT类型支持有符号和无符号,分别对应-2147483648到2147483647和0到4294967295的范围。BIGINT类型同样支持有符号和无符号,范围为-9223372036854775808到9223372036854775807和0到18446744073709551615。
数据库
数据类型
编程
MySQL用命令行复制表的方法
编程
MySQL用命令行复制表的方法
2024-11-17 05:03:46 +0800 CST
view 3022
本文介绍了在MySQL中使用命令行复制表结构的方法,包括只复制表结构、复制表结构及数据、以及在表结构相同或不同的情况下复制数据的多种方式。具体命令包括CREATETABLE和INSERTINTO的用法,强调了不同方法在复制主键和字段类型方面的差异。
数据库
MySQL
数据管理
编程
mysql删除重复数据
2024-11-19 03:19:52 +0800 CST
view 3126
本文介绍了如何在联系人数据库中查找和删除重复的uid。首先,通过SQL查询找出所有重复的uid,然后使用删除语句去除重复记录,保留每组uid中的最小id。提供了相应的SQL代码示例,帮助用户理解操作过程。
数据库
SQL
数据处理
Python标准库中的sqlite3模块,提供了轻量级的数据库解决方案
编程
Python标准库中的sqlite3模块,提供了轻量级的数据库解决方案
2024-11-17 08:12:20 +0800 CST
view 1512
本文介绍了Python标准库中的sqlite3模块,提供了轻量级的数据库解决方案。通过简单的代码示例,展示了如何创建数据库和表、插入、查询、更新和删除数据,以及如何处理潜在的数据库错误。SQLite适合嵌入式应用,易于使用,适合开发小型应用和快速数据操作。
数据库
Python
编程
数据管理
SQLite
ClickHouse 4亿美元D轮融资深度解析:从OLAP王者到AI数据基础设施的野心布局
编程
ClickHouse 4亿美元D轮融资深度解析:从OLAP王者到AI数据基础设施的野心布局
2026-04-22 02:18:30 +0800 CST
view 415
ClickHouse完成4亿美元D轮融资,收购Langfuse进军LLM可观测性领域,推出原生Postgres服务。深度解析ClickHouse技术架构、收购战略意义及AI数据基础设施布局。
ClickHouse
OLAP
数据库
AI基础设施
LLM可观测性
Postgres
数据分析
PyMySQL - Python中非常有用的库
编程
PyMySQL - Python中非常有用的库
2024-11-18 14:43:28 +0800 CST
view 1378
PyMySQL是一个纯Python实现的MySQL客户端库,允许Python程序员与MySQL数据库交互。本文介绍了PyMySQL的安装、基本用法、高级特性及实际应用案例,涵盖了连接数据库、执行SQL语句、事务处理和CRUD操作等内容,旨在帮助读者快速掌握这一强大的库。
Python
数据库
开发工具
数据分析
Web开发
Pathway 深度解析:当 Rust 遇见实时数据流——AI 时代高性能实时 ETL 的工程革命
编程
Pathway 深度解析:当 Rust 遇见实时数据流——AI 时代高性能实时 ETL 的工程革命
2026-04-14 16:26:21 +0800 CST
view 194
深度解析 Pathway 的架构设计、增量计算引擎、Rust 核心并行调度,以及如何用 Python 构建生产级实时 RAG 数据管道。
Rust
Python
AI
RAG
ETL
实时数据
向量数据库
Pathway
MySQL的事务和回滚功能来回滚数据库中某张表的更新操作
编程
MySQL的事务和回滚功能来回滚数据库中某张表的更新操作
2024-11-19 06:15:08 +0800 CST
view 1239
本文介绍了如何使用MySQL的事务和回滚功能来回滚数据库中某张表的更新操作。通过详细的步骤和代码示例,读者可以学习到开启事务、更新表、检查更新、回滚操作、检查回滚和提交事务的具体流程,确保数据操作的准确性和安全性。
数据库
事务管理
数据安全
编程
MySQL 日志详解
2024-11-19 02:17:30 +0800 CST
view 1429
MySQL日志是数据库管理的重要组成部分,记录运行状态信息,关键于异常排查、性能优化和数据恢复。主要分为Server层日志和引擎层日志,包括错误日志、二进制日志、查询日志、慢查询日志、重做日志和撤销日志。RedoLog用于事务持久性,Binlog用于数据备份和主从复制。两者各有特点,共同确保数据完整性和一致性。
数据库
日志管理
性能监控
数据恢复
MySQL
Elasticsearch 的索引操作
编程
Elasticsearch 的索引操作
2024-11-19 03:41:41 +0800 CST
view 1453
Elasticsearch的索引操作包括创建、查看、更新、删除索引及索引文档和维护等。创建索引时可定义映射和设置,使用RESTAPI进行操作。更新索引设置和删除索引也通过特定的HTTP请求完成。此外,索引文档是将文档添加到索引的过程。Elasticsearch提供索引维护功能,如优化和刷新,以管理性能和存储效率。
Elasticsearch
数据库
搜索引擎
数据管理
API
DuckDB 深度实战:从零构建高性能数据分析引擎,嵌入式 OLAP 的终极指南
编程
DuckDB 深度实战:从零构建高性能数据分析引擎,嵌入式 OLAP 的终极指南
2026-04-27 18:23:00 +0800 CST
view 131
DuckDB 深度解析:从架构设计到代码实战,全面剖析这款嵌入式分析型数据库的核心原理、性能优化技巧和生产环境实践。
DuckDB
嵌入式数据库
OLAP
数据分析
SQL
Python
列式存储
向量化执行
一个简单的示例演示了如何在MySQL中进行分库分表及分页查询
编程
一个简单的示例演示了如何在MySQL中进行分库分表及分页查询
2024-11-18 22:28:35 +0800 CST
view 1477
本文通过一个简单的示例演示了如何在MySQL中进行分库分表及分页查询。首先创建测试数据库和用户表,插入随机数据,然后将用户表拆分为两张表,并根据id奇偶分配数据。接着,使用MERGE引擎创建合并表以便于分页查询,最后展示了如何进行分页查询和删除操作。此示例适合初学者实践。
数据库
MySQL
数据管理
编程
技术教程
大家都在搜索什么?
devops
易支付
一个官网+多少钱
统一接受回调
统一回调
sub
node
宝塔日志
mysql
shell
ElasticSearch
css
vue
api接口对接
2025
支付接口对接
go
php
php回调
回调
上一页
1
2
3
4
...
21
下一页